Abstract
In steam power generation systems, operational stability and safety are highly dependent on water level control in the steam drum. However, the complexity of system dynamics and potential actuator disturbances make this control a very interesting topic for discussion. This study proposes Fault Tolerant Control (FTC) based on Extended State Observer (ESO) that is capable of detecting and compensating for actuator disturbances in real time. A nonlinear dynamic model of the steam drum is derived based on the principles of mass and energy balance, then linearized to construct a state-space system. Two actuator disturbance scenarios-step signal addition and ramp signal addition-are analyzed to evaluate the effectiveness of FTC. Simulation results show that the FTC system can maintain water level control performance to reach the setpoint despite disturbances. The ESO also successfully estimates disturbance values accurately, making this approach suitable for industrial control systems requiring resistance to actuator disturbances.
